vue步驟型表單快取上一步頁面

2021-08-09 13:27:00 字數 552 閱讀 2099

在移動端開始時,在步驟型表單時比如a->b->c,我們經常需要快取上一步的頁面級資料。本文介紹通過路由元資訊以及vue的keep-alive來實現。

}

v-if="$route.meta.keepalive">

router-view>

keep-alive>

v-if="!$route.meta.keepalive">

router-view>

div>

template>

to.meta['frompath'] = from.path;

if (from.path == '/index/ywbl' || from.path == '/index') else

next();

},if (this.$route.meta['needfresh'])

} 當然了還有其他方式,比如說我們可以把填寫了的資料放入到vuex中管理。然後到頁面的時候再實現賦值等方法。

vue快取頁面,返回上一頁不重新整理

2 在路由處新增keepalive屬性 component import views device daddress hidden true 3 在需要快取的頁面使用activated方法 beforerouteenter to,from,next next activated this.route...

JS應用,表單上的一些東西

例 這樣看起來很麻煩,我們可以通過操作屬性來判斷.通過id獲取值,var a document.getelementbyid id a.setattribute 屬性名 屬性值 設定乙個屬性,新增或更改都可以 disabled a.getattribute 屬性名 獲取屬性的值 a.removeat...

form表單中button按鈕返回上一頁解決辦法

解決form中button按鈕不好用的問題解決辦法。方法一 1.在form表單標籤中國增加乙個屬性,如下圖,紅框處 2.返回按鈕樣式 3.onclick方法需要跳轉的頁面,遮擋處為需要返回的頁面 方法二 1.把button按鈕的標籤換成input標籤,那麼form標籤中就不用填寫action屬性,如...